Handover — cron migration to Flowstead

For new folks: we're moving the legacy cron jobs on the Barrowby boxes into the Flowstead workflow engine. Twelve of nineteen jobs migrated; remaining ones are in the tracker, tagged by owner. Gotchas: the nightly reconcile job must stay single-instance, and Flowstead's timezone default differs from cron's. Old crontabs stay read-only until signoff. To open the migration credentials locker, use the recovery passphrase below.

unlock words, yawig-kagef: gordor-holvan-ulaael-pramir-ulaiel-tamdor

To the board. Proposed training budget for next year: up 12% over current. Drivers: certification renewals for the Halverton plant crews, onboarding for the expanded Brisk line support team, and management courses tied to the new appraisal cycle. Cuts made: external conference travel trimmed by half; vendor-led workshops consolidated under one provider. Net effect fits within the operating envelope agreed in spring. Approval requested at the next sitting; detail pack follows separately. The confidential rationale is appended below.

management briefing: Headcount on the Quenael team goes from 9 to 80 by the end of July. Gross margin on Quenael came in at 15 percent against a plan of 20 percent.

Reworks the Dovetail dispatch heuristic. Old scorer weighted distance only, which starved drivers on the Ashfen periphery. New version blends ETA, acceptance history, and idle time, with a decay on stale pings. No behavior change when the candidate pool is under three drivers. Benchmarks in the PR checks. Scoring weights and cutoffs are centralized in the constants listed below.

tuning constants:
QUOTAS = {
    "druwyn": 5,
    "holix": 5,
    "zorath": 5,
    "holwyn": 10,
}

**Q: How does the waveform preview in Quillcast handle untrusted audio uploads?**

A: The preview renderer runs in a sandboxed worker with no network access. Uploaded files are decoded by the Pellum transcoder, which rejects malformed headers before any peak data is computed. Waveform images are generated server-side and served as static PNGs, so no client-side decoding of user audio occurs. Reviewers needing to inspect the sandbox host directly should authenticate with the recovery passphrase below.

vault phrase of bagaf-kajeg = jorath-feniel-briir-siliel-ralix